Output 073a126e52f5cefa5646034c1990b988dec0712d01de34b91796f287592c2236:0

value
7382936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94e8bd2fc35baaf15b9997d5bae218d8eb3fad3f OP_EQUAL
address
3FGNjvaWbLJFgsuX55RzaBGXES4n66HyxJ
transaction
073a126e52f5cefa5646034c1990b988dec0712d01de34b91796f287592c2236
confirmations
317948
spent
true